Everything works perfect but it won't wake up from sleep. I get a black monitor and case fans come on. That's it. I have to force shutdown with button and switch off power supply. I have the latest Catalyst drivers. Any ideas what's going on?
 
The only other thing I can think of hardware wise is the PSU. I once had one that worked fine in everything but sleep, and when replaced sleep worked too.

Other than that, is it a fresh install of Windows and are the chipset drivers up to date?

Edit: might be worth playing with the various sleep modes (S3/S4 etc) in the BIOS, but really any of them should work.
